Output fca31cc3af87b865a94c022df753cd7214504d23cff4eac9d9b0209654a8c01e:2

value
33772012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911e91e2a66379b1e149c2ce8b538e5c8e2ea1d2 OP_EQUAL
address
MM8UqH2Bt9sbhn9dgscHZbEwHJtJsTAwBj
transaction
fca31cc3af87b865a94c022df753cd7214504d23cff4eac9d9b0209654a8c01e
spent
true